Pan-Seared Chicken Meatballs

These golden-brown chicken meatballs are crispy on the outside, tender inside, and pack a flavor punch that'll make you forget all about their beefy cousins. Trust me - the secret splash of fish sauce in these 30-minute wonders will have everyone begging for seconds.

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 20 minutes
Total Time: 30 minutes
Servings: 4 people

Ingredients
 

  • 1 pound ground chicken
  • ½ cup plain breadcrumbs
  • 1 teaspoon kosher salt
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per
  • 3 garlic cloves minced or crushed
  • ½ teaspoon crushed red pepper
  • ¼ onion finely diced
  • ¼ cup parsley finely chopped
  • 1 teaspoon fish sauce or soy sauce optional
  • ¼ cup parmesan cheese grated
  • 1 egg lightly whisked
  • 3 tablespoons neutral oil

Instructions

  • To begin, whisk together the salt, pepper, garlic, crushed red pepper, onion, parsley, fish sauce, and egg.
    1 teaspoon kosher salt, ¼ teaspoon black pepper, 3 garlic cloves, ½ teaspoon crushed red pepper, ¼ onion, ¼ cup parsley, 1 teaspoon fish sauce or soy sauce, 1 egg
  • Add the chicken, bread crumbs, and parmesan and mix well to combine.
    Tip: Take about 1 teaspoon of your meatball mixture and microwave it on high for 20 seconds. This allows you to taste your meatballs for seasoning before it’s too late! Taste and adjust for seasoning to your preference.
    1 pound ground chicken, ½ cup plain breadcrumbs, ¼ cup parmesan cheese
  • Heat oil in a large, non-stick skillet over medium heat. Once the oil is shimmering, using wet hands, roll your mixture into meatballs about 1.5” large and carefully place in the preheated pan.
    Tip: Run your hands under cold water before forming the meatballs. It will prevent the ground meat from sticking to your hands. You can also try spraying your hands with cooking spray!
    3 tablespoons neutral oil
  • Allow the meatballs to cook, undisturbed for 5 minutes until a deep brown crust has formed on the bottom. Carefully, flip the meatballs to the other side and cook for an additional 5 minutes, until the meatballs are cooked through.
  • Enjoy as a snack or serve with your favorite pasta and sauce and enjoy!
